Yusen no Yado Yu-am, operated by Ai and F Building Co., Ltd., has released a collaborative video with the YouTube channel "Puriko no Hitori Sanpo." This video introduces the attractions of the castle town Izushi and YUMURA ONSEN, featuring tourist spots, local cuisine, traditional crafts, and the appeal of the hot spring inn.

Q: What kind of inn is Yusen no Yado Yu-am?
A: It is a hot spring inn in YUMURA ONSEN, Hyogo Prefecture, characterized by its Japanese-modern design inspired by the Toyooka Kiryu-zaiku craft. Guests can enjoy in-room open-air baths and meals made with local ingredients.
Q: What is featured in the video "Puriko no Hitori Sanpo"?
A: The video showcases the charms of Izushi, including Izushi Castle Ruins, Tatsunokoro, Izushi soba noodles, and Toyooka Kiryu-zaiku crafts, along with the accommodation experience at Yusen no Yado Yu-am in YUMURA ONSEN.
Q: How is the access from Izushi to YUMURA ONSEN?
A: It takes approximately 65 minutes by car. A model course combining Izushi sightseeing with an overnight stay in YUMURA ONSEN is proposed.
Q: What is the dining like at Yusen no Yado Yu-am?
A: They offer creative kaiseki meals focusing on ingredients and designed to be "gentle on the body" for both dinner and breakfast.
